Polycystic ovarian syndrome (PCOS) is a prevalent heterogeneous disorder affecting 5%-20% of women of reproductive age (Azziz et al., 2016).Even though Stein and Leventhal initially reported the condition in 1935, most PCOS-affected women still go misdiagnosed or undiagnosed. Symptoms typically emerge between the ages of 18 and 39 years, but diagnosis and treatment are often delayed, leading to many undiagnosed patients (Dason et al., 2024).It is identified by symptoms such as excessive hair growth, acne, high insulin levels, and irregular menstrual cycles (Meier, 2018).Metabolic issues, like insulin resistance (IR)and obesity, are present in 60 to 80 % of women.
